Q: Is 576,453 a Prime Number?
A: No, 576,453 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 576453 can be evenly divided by 1 3 17 51 89 127 267 381 1,513 2,159 4,539 6,477 11,303 33,909 192,151 and 576,453, with no remainder.
Since 576,453 cannot be divided by just 1 and 576,453, it is not a prime number.
